37 // These are just tiny non-functional vectors and handlers for when
38 // their functionality is not being used. They just try to signal
39 // the debugger that an unhandled exception or interrupt occurred,
40 // and otherwise just spin in a loop.
42 // For interrupts levels above DEBUGLEVEL, lowering PS.INTLEVEL
43 // for break to work is tricky, and not always possible in a
44 // generic fashion without interfering with normal program execution.
45 // So for now we don't do it.
